i want to be a marine more then anything i have ever wanted to do, there is only one problem i have had two misdemeanors in my past
1)evading arrest age 12 did probation, not on my record 2) possesion of marijuana age 14 did probation not on my record although they are not on my record, i hear that the military does have access to the records another thing, recently i was pulled over and there was marijuana in my car, not mine but i was charged and i go to court tomorrow, i have a lawyer and there is a good chance it is getting dissmised, although like the others i dont know if the military will have access to this. i am 18 years old, i have clean urine, i have a high school diploma and im trying to get off to a good start in life although i was not such a bright little youngster. what are my chances of getting in, will someone please give me some more info relating to my concerns. it would be greatly appreciated. |

Short answer is yes the marine corps will find out about it. There is no reason not to disclose those offenses to a recruiter. We run waivers for possesion of MJ so you should be fine. Even if the second one doesn't get dropped you should could get a waiver. But if you want to be a marine then from now on distance your self from anything or anyone involved with drugs.
